Does hyperthyroidism affect Dental Implants?

A patient with hyperthyroid can definitely get a dental implant provided the patients thyroid levels are within normal limit after medication, and there are no other contraindication for the same. How can I permanently cure bad breath when eating?
You may have halitosis, which is the scientific name for the condition we commonly refer to as bad breath. Even though you properly care for your oral hygiene, bad breath may still occur. This may be because of the kinds of food you eat, dry mouth, or the leftover food particles stuck inside your mouth. If you want to solve this challenge, practice drinking more water, chewing sugar-free gums, and crunchy veggies and fruits.

Why Do I Have Unhealthy Tongue with Purple Patches?
Oral lichen planus might often show up as purple and white spots on the surface of the tongue that may or may not include a covering. It might not be infectious, however, it might be very annoying. Due to immune system dysfunction or stress can be a contributing circumstance. Eliminate spicy foods or abrasive brushing to relieve the suffering. Gargling with the help of salt can also be a relief. If you do not experience any alleviation, consult a dentist for a proper check-up and cure.

What is the solution for my painful dental cavities?
Your condition may have resulted in dental caries, which in turn causes intense dental pain. Dental caries are the product of the bacteria in the mouth that make holes in the teeth. This can happen if you consume sugary substances excessively. You can mainly do this by brushing your teeth regularly twice a day and also regularly visiting the dentist as advised. The dentist can effectively treat dental caries using a filling to make your teeth strong.

Is Red Bump Inside My Mouth Cancerous?
You may be worried if a red bump pops up inside your mouth. However, it is not always a sign of cancer. These bumps can be caused by mouth sores, inflamed taste buds, or even a small injury from rough foods. If it is not causing pain or bleeding, then it is usually the case of nothing serious. Try rinsing your mouth with salt water and using soothing mouth gel to help it heal. If it does not get better or if you are scared, it is always a good idea to see a dentist.
